hearing Ted Christopher, driver of the Ted Marsh #13 Whelen Chevy will leave the team for a 2000 full time BGN ride in 2000. Supposedly Steve Park will drive the the #13 in some short track events next year — UPDATE hearing Steve Park will drive the #13 Whelen Chevy at Homestead, replacing Ted Christopher. Park is also rumored to be driving the #13 in a limited schedule in 2000 — UPDATE 2: I hear that Steve Park will announce Saturday a Busch deal with Whelen as the sponsor…about 15 races but schedule wont be known until NASCAR announces BGN schedule — UPDATE 3: I hear the car will be #84 for Park — UPDATE 4: In a press conference Saturday, Steve Park announced he will run 15 BGN races in 2000 for Ted Marsh in the Whelen Engineering Chevy. The team will run its first race in Nov in the hotwheels.com 300 at Homestead-Miami Speedway( NOL )
